Medical Records Breach in Detroit

DETROIT (myFOXDetroit.com) - The personal information for thousands of Detroiters could be at risk. They're patients of the Detroit Health Department.

Five computers were stolen from the immunization program at the Herman Kiefer Health Center. One desktop PC contained Medicare and Medcaid information on individuals.

"The number is approximately 10,000 individuals," said Michael McElrath with the Detroit Department of Health and Wellness Promotion. "We have letters right now to 2,700 of them. They are the ones that we have actual valid addresses for. Once they receive the letter, they should respond to us and give us a call as quickly as possible."

Another security breach occurred when a flash drive was stolen from an employees car parked at the Herman Kiefer lot.

Many of the medical records stolen contain vital information, such as names, addresses, medicaid and Social Security numbers.

File stolen include birth certificate information for Detroit residents in the 48202 and 48205 zip codes for all of 2008 and the first half of 2009.

The health department has sent letters to people affected by the security breach.

"We're providing mitigation for that circumstance. If there is any kind of credit fraud, we're providing credit monitoring to those individuals," McElrath said.

The employee whose flash drive was stolen was disciplined.

"Removing any type of medical records, health information... birth certificate information is against the Detroit Health Department's policy, and the individual that had this happen was changing computers at the time. Put information into a flash drive," said William Ridella with the Detroit Department of Health and Wellness Promotion.
